Guy Martin joins McGuinness in Honda TT squad

Guy Martin has signed a sensational deal to join John McGuinness in the official Honda Racing team for this year’s Isle of Man TT.

The Lincolnshire rider missed out on last year’s event after electing to take part in the Tour Divide mountain bike ride in America but is back for 2017.

“Neil Tuxworth has been talking to me for a while about joining the team, but I had a lot of thinking to do before I committed and said yes. I spent a lot of time on my push bike to and from work, thinking about what to do. I didn’t want to grow old regretting not giving the Honda a go, and the more time passes since making the decision, the more time I’ve thought it is the right decision,” said Martin.

“Honda is a great team and the Fireblade has always been a weapon on the roads, so with the new bike, I‘m keen to give it a go. We’ve got a busy testing schedule coming up and I’ve put some other stuff off to make time. John is the man, I’ve got massive respect for him and I’m looking forward to racing on the Fireblade against him.”

Martin will use the brand new Fireblade SP2 on the Island, plus the North West 200, Ulster Grand Prix, Southern 100 and at Armoy.

He will test for four days in Spain with the team before going on to the traditional Castle Combe two-day evaluation.
